Madman Entertainment to Release Generation One Complete Collection and More!

Discuss anything about the Transformers cartoons and comics! You can discuss anything from G1 to Cybertron as well as the comics from Marvel, Dreamwave, IDW and more!

Madman Entertainment to Release Generation One Complete Collection and More!

Postby Calenatarion » Fri Apr 27, 2007 6:59 am

Just in is a new press release from `Madman Entertainment.

There has been a lot of demand for Madman's Tranformers the Movie: Special Edition and Madman is about to statisfy our needs for that release. They will release this special edtion together with a Generation One Complete Collection! This special Collection will feature a very nice box in the Generation One toy box style.

But the fun doesn't end here. From May 10th Madman will also release a number of interesting Transformers merchandise. They will release items like an Autobot/Decepticon cap, an Autobot hoody and much more

TRANSFORMERS GENERATION 1 COMPLETE COLLECTION

The epic clashes of Optimus Prime & Megatron, & their future successors, are complete in an age-old struggle for control of the universe, as vehicles and devices transform into mighty robots; one side to protect, the other to conquer!

This 17 disc collector’s tin contains every Transformers episode, season 1-4, in one box, designed by the Transformers fans at Madman to authentically match the look and feel of the original 1984 toy boxes, down to character art, the original back of battle scene and tech specs!

The booklet contains a never seen before, exclusive comic from IDW Publishing by writer Simon Furman and artist Nick Roche will tell a missing chapter in the story of the Transformers!

- Interviews with key figures from Transformer's 20 year history
- Animated Public Service Announcements
- Historical trailers
- Scripts & storyboards
- Interview and commentary with Voice Director Wally Burr
- Television commercials
- Limited Edition Packaging
- 16 page booklet containing exclusive comic by Simon Furman"

Wait a sec...

THIS ISN'T FOR NORTH AMERICA, IS IT?

Madman is an Australian company, so this is a Region 4 release, not a Region 1 release. These are the guys who put out Voltron in Australia, and they weren't allowed to put Voltron out in North America. So I don't think this will be any different.

Unless you've got a region-free player (which I do, but many folks don't), then this isn't something most USA fans can enjoy.
